How Much Does an APM Certification Really Cost?

Obtaining your APM certification is a fantastic way to demonstrate your expertise in application performance management. However, it's essential to understand the financial implications before embarking on this journey. The actual cost of an APM certification can fluctuate considerably depending on several factors. These factors include the specific certification you're pursuing, the company offering the program, and any ancillary expenses like exam fees or study materials.

Generally speaking, you can budget for APM certifications to range roughly $500 to $1500. This expense often encompasses access to training resources, exam attempts, and access to professional communities. It's crucial to carefully research different certification programs and compare their costs before making a decision. Components Affecting APM Certification Outlays

Achieving an APM certification can be a worthwhile investment in your professional development. However, the charge of obtaining this credential can fluctuate depending on several factors. One key factor is the specific certification program you choose. Some programs are more intensive than others, requiring additional learning aids, which can alter the overall price.

The locale where you pursue your certification can also exert a role in the costs. Training programs and exam fees can fluctuate based on regional factors. For example, big-city areas may have higher prices compared to rural communities.

Furthermore, your ongoing knowledge and experience in project management can influence the time and assets required for certification preparation. Individuals with a strong basis may require less intensive education, resulting in lower costs.
